I tried this. Easy to use it isn't. You have to:
1. Find the restriction on mapbox's site;
2. Make the edit on OSM;
3. Mark the change as done on mapbox's site;
4. Discuss any changes on github, which requires a github account
and takes OSM change discussion away from OSM servers onto
a third party.
OSM already has the tools to handle this:
1. Drop Map Notes at the contested turn restrictions;
2. Provide a WMS or other iD/josm compatible imagery layer if need be.
